Tiriba - a new approach of UAV based on model driven development and multiprocessors

This paper presents the technical details of Tiriba, which is a small autonomous electrical airplane used into pre-defined missions and applications such as agricultural and environmental monitoring. This class of aircrafts has taken advantage of the miniaturization of electronic components and modules such as GPS receivers, digital cameras, wireless communication equipment, and other sensors. One of the main components of Tiriba is the autopilot module, which is capable to control the aircraft and keep it in a predefined route. This paper addresses the use of model driven development of the system and its multiprocessor platform to support the four components that compose the UAV control software architecture.
